In Working it Out, you will study the work of George Herbert, a 17th-century poet, with an emphasis on seeing the movement of thought within each poem. Though Working it Out was written primarily as a devotional, the book models a thoughtful method for reading and understanding poetry in general.In Working it Out you will learn to see:- The Big Picture: what the poem is about-The Parts of the Picture: a stanza-by-stanza explication of the poem.-The Parts of the Picture Come Together: a look at the movement of thought through the poem.When a foundation of understanding is established, you may choose to move into the devotional elements of each chapter, which include:-Reflections: questions for personal meditation.-Scriptures for Further ReflectionBy the time you finish a year of study in this book, you will have a structured method that you can use to read and understand any poem. Womack's models will help you see how a poet can use tone and nuance, as well as a variety of literary devices, to convey an idea.
